#61 Le 20/09/2006, à 17:49

Krouteux

Re : Installation de v4l pour hauppauge Hvr-1100

Je crois que ton problème vient du fait que nous n'avons pas les mêmes carte tuner, j'ai lu sur des forums qu'il y avait deux types de hvr-1100 differente, certaines avec un chipset connexant cx88 et d'autres avec un chipset philips SAA7133. Ce tuto fonctionne pour les cartes munit d'un chipset connexant, il se peut que pour faire fonctionner cette carte il faille charger d'autres modules.

modprobe saa7134

Tu peux trouver des informations sur ces cartes dans /v4l-dvb/linux/Documentation/video4linux/

#72 Le 30/10/2006, à 16:17

tomlohave

Re : Installation de v4l pour hauppauge Hvr-1100

Rectification : je pense qu'il est question d'une 1110 (regarde la puce de la carte)

Donc dans ce cas le problème est réglé ...

Si tu veux juste la tnt :

modprobe -r saa7134-alsa saa7134 && modprobe saa7134 card=101 && modprobe saa7134-dvb

Si tu veux la radio, la tv et la tnt c'est par ici :
http://linuxtv.org/pipermail/linux-dvb/ … 13916.html

Il faut encore patienter ... mais cela ne devrait plus tarder tongue

#74 Le 30/10/2006, à 16:59

tomlohave

Re : Installation de v4l pour hauppauge Hvr-1100

Le problème provient certainement de
modprobe saa7134 card=101

Ta version de v4l-dvb doit être trop ancienne ...

sudo apt-get install build-essential mercurial linux-headers-`uname -r`

puis

hg clone http://linuxtv.org/hg/v4l-dvb
cd v4l-dvb
make
sudo make install

et refaire les manips précisées avant après avoir redémarré
